dc.description.abstract Industrial training is among the requirements needed for students of various programs to accomplished in order to graduate, it' s done at the middle of the course e.g. after one year for a two year course and after two years for four years course, students are expected to leave there campuses to get exposed to new practical skills in various field and supervisor at the end, then after expected to write a report and submit for marking, Internship aimed at producing higher trained students in practical skills to enhance field and job creativity in community and put in place existing theory into practical skill obtained, Activities conducted during industrial training include, cleaning of diary unite, feed formulation, pasture management, green house production, weeding of banana garden, feeding of pigs, dehorning, disbudding ,trellising in tomatoes spraying and planting of maize. Therefore, my main objectives were to attained knowledge in the following sections • animal section Cattle management • Breeds and daily routine management in piggery • Parasites and disease identification in pigs • Control measures • Feed formulation • Banana production • Green House production • Land marking • Pastures management • Agronomic practices, poultry, and orchard management, small ruminants and seed bed preparation. The training however was successful since most of the aims/objectives were attained during our internship, we were divided into groups for easy mobilization each under one leader and we were to move from one section to another from one week to another respectfully, our internship used to be conducted from morning 7:30am until you finish the work depending on your commitment, however each section had its own instructor to guide the learners, our intern took us 10 weeks. Therefore, we observed that we were missing a lot in class since most practical skills were impacted during internship. we also observed that most farmers were lacking a lot especially in field marking and agronomic practices hence lowering their Productivity and we therefore recommend crop officers should be trained to help farmers achieve long and short term objectives in production and minimize losses affecting their enterprises. I also advice our university to give students more time and allocate more resources in internship sections since it has more positive impact to students towards achieving the nearby future career. en_US
